Understanding the Nature of ChatGPT

Before diving into the specifics of prompt creation, it’s vital to understand what ChatGPT is. Built on the GPT (Generative Pre-trained Transformer) architecture, ChatGPT is designed to generate human-like text based on the input it receives. The model operates by predicting the next word in a sequence, which allows it to respond to queries, follow instructions, or engage in conversations.

The effectiveness of ChatGPT is largely determined by the quality of the prompt provided. A well-structured prompt can lead to informative and relevant responses, while a poorly framed question may yield vague or off-topic results.

Fundamental Principles of Prompt Creation

When creating prompts for ChatGPT, there are several underlying principles to consider:

1. Be Clear and Concise

Unambiguous prompts foster better communication. Instead of asking, “Tell me about global warming,” specify what aspect interests you: “What are the main causes of global warming?” Clear prompts minimize confusion about what type of information you’re seeking.

Example:


  • Less effective

    : “Tell me about technology.”

  • More effective

    : “What are the latest advancements in artificial intelligence for natural language processing?”

2. Provide Context

Contextualizing a prompt can help frame the conversation and guide ChatGPT toward a more accurate response. Consider including relevant details or situational context.

Example:


  • Less effective

    : “How do I write a book?”

  • More effective

    : “As a first-time author writing a science fiction novel, what are some tips to develop an engaging plot?”

3. Be Specific

Specificity helps narrow down the scope of responses. Instead of open-ended questions, focus on specific elements that require information or insight.

Example:


  • Less effective

    : “What can you tell me about exercise?”

  • More effective

    : “What are the health benefits of aerobic exercise compared to strength training?”

4. Use Questions Wisely

Framing prompts as questions can elicit informative responses. However, ensure that questions are open-ended enough to invite comprehensive answers while still being focused enough to avoid ambiguity.

Example:


  • Less effective

    : “Discuss climate change.”

  • More effective

    : “How does climate change impact biodiversity, particularly in coastal ecosystems?”

5. Test and Iterate

Experimentation is also an essential aspect of prompt creation. After receiving a response, consider the effectiveness of the prompt. If the answer wasn’t what you expected, refine the question and try again. This iterative process helps in understanding how the AI interprets different types of queries.

Advanced Techniques for Crafting Prompts

Though the foundational principles are essential, there are also advanced techniques that can further enhance the effectiveness of your prompts.

1. Role-Playing

You can ask the AI to assume a specific role or expertise. This technique can guide the response style and tone, making interactions more dynamic. This is especially useful for simulated conversations or professional contexts.

Example:

  • “As a fitness coach, what personalized workout plan would you recommend for a beginner looking to lose weight?”

2. Multi-Part Prompts

Consider using multi-part prompts to explore various dimensions of a topic. This technique allows you to glean a comprehensive understanding by breaking down the inquiry into parts.

Example:

  • “What are the main principles of Buddhism? Additionally, how do these principles apply to everyday life practices?”

3. Use of Examples

When seeking explanations or guidance, providing examples can clarify what kind of response you are looking for. This encourages the AI to tailor its response more closely to your needs.

Example:

  • “Can you provide a step-by-step guide to creating an effective presentation? For example, include tips on visuals and engaging the audience.”

4. Define the Format of the Response

You can specify how you want the information presented. Whether you’re looking for bullet points, a summary, or an in-depth analysis, indicating your preferred format can yield better results.

Example:

  • “Can you summarize the key findings from the 2020 UN Climate Report in bullet points?”

5. Requesting Comparisons

Encouraging comparisons or contrasts can elicit insightful responses. This approach can help in decision-making processes or deepen understanding of a subject.

Example:

  • “What are the advantages and disadvantages of solar energy compared to wind energy?”

Common Pitfalls to Avoid

As with any skill, there are common mistakes to be aware of when crafting prompts. Avoiding these pitfalls can help you interact more effectively with ChatGPT.

1. Vague Language

Using ambiguous or non-specific language can lead to irrelevant or unfocused responses. Make your prompts as clear and detailed as possible.

2. Overly Complex Queries

While it’s important to be specific, overly complicated or convoluted prompts can confuse the AI. Keep your sentences well-structured and to the point.

3. Neglecting Context

Forgetting to provide context can result in off-topic responses. Always consider what essential background information is necessary for generating an appropriate answer.

4. Lack of Focus

Asking multiple questions in one prompt can dilute the AI’s focus. If you have several questions, consider breaking them down into separate prompts.

5. Not Utilizing Feedback

Ignoring the AI’s responses can limit your ability to refine your prompts. Always review the answers you receive and learn from them to improve future prompts.
